    This year, St. Vincent’s Hospice marks 30 years of providing specialist care to people and families who are affected by life limiting conditions in Renfrewshire and beyond.

    Our story began in 1983, when members of the St. Vincent De Paul Society identified the need to care for people with terminal illnesses in the local area. This marked the beginning of a five-year campaign: The St. Vincent’s Hospice Project.

    Thanks to their tireless efforts, in 1987 they were able to purchase a house and after a year of renovation, we opened our doors to patients on the 25th of January 1988 at North Road in Johnstone.
